FES/BLD/18/45034 400 LEVEL Block Molding For the molding of the blocks a mix ratio of 1:6 was used, which produces about 40 6" blocks and 30 to 35 9" blocks. Lintels The reinforcements used for the lintels are 12mm rods for runners and 10mm rods for stirrups. Concrete mix ratio of 1:4:4 and 1:2:2 used interchangeably for casting. Block-work Forming This involves creating or constructing walls or partitions using building blocks Block Setting This is accurately positioning the building blocks according to the architectural drawing or design. Concrete Fascia Horizontal panels made of concrete, placed on the outer edge of a building's exterior wall. Beams Horizontal structural members that support the weight of floors, roofs, and other elements. Columns Vertical structural members that transfer loads from beams and other components to the foundation. Staircase A structure consisting of threads and risers Suspended Floor Slab Structural elements that are supported by beams, columns , or walls. Concrete Curing The process of maintaining favorable moisture and temperature conditions to facilitate hydration, which enables the concrete to gain strength and attain its desired properties.
